Canadian and U.S. operators recently gathered at the Hilton Barbados to reconnect and to be honoured by the Barbados Tourism Authority. Tourist visits to Barbados are holding their own fairly well compared to fellow Caribbean islands and, in fact, Canadian visits are up about 11% primarily due to the introduction of WestJet service last winter. The U.S. and British numbers are down though, resulting in an overall drop in visitation of about 15% - but even that is on the low end compared to Caribbean traffic decline in general.

Barbados has so many Canadian connections – not only from the welcomed increase in air lift – but from a history of Canadian investment and repeat visits to the island. The Friends of Barbados club recognizes all those who have made more than 25 visits to the island – and the majority of that group are Canadians.

During the event WestJet, Air Canada Vacations and Thomas Cook Group Canada were all recognized for their continued product enhancements. Air Canada Vacations is launching its B & B and guest house product – an interesting option for an island that offers a great variety of accommodation options that suit the destination’s vibe. It’s a place where people should get out and take in the wide variety of local restaurants – definitely not an all inclusive “don’t venture out from your resort†destination.

WestJet is about to start daily flights from Toronto again for the high season and hopes to continue service year round. Holiday House and Fun Sun also have great expectations for Barbados with their new dynamic packaging “TravelGenie†engine – ideal for the FIT product that suits destination Barbados.

The group of operators also included big American names Expedia (who were honoured with the award for biggest growth in sales), Travelocity and Orbitz. The entire group was hosted to an opening reception at the historic Ilaro Court – the official residence of the Prime Minister the Hon. David Thompson. The house was originally built in the early 1900’s as the governor’s home and is set amid beautiful gardens alive with loudly chirping tree frogs. The coral and limestone home has large gracious drawing rooms and a lovely open central courtyard often used for official occasions.
